Chapter One: The Original Meaning of "Great Heat" — The Extreme of Summer's Swelter
I. Why Is "Heat" Written as Shu$5
Before entering the specific discussion of Great Heat, we must first contemplate the character shu (暑, "summer heat") itself. Why was shu chosen to name the most sweltering period of the year$6 What is the original meaning of this character$7 And how does it differ from other characters for heat, such as re (热, "hot"), yan (炎, "blazing"), and jiao (焦, "scorching")$8
Master Xu Shen in the Shuowen Jiezi writes: "Shu means heat. It takes 'sun' (ri) as its signific element, with zhe as phonetic." This is a phonosemantic compound; the component "sun" indicates meaning, revealing a direct connection to the sun and sunlight. Yet merely saying "shu means heat" does not fully disclose the distinctive connotations of shu.
In classical Chinese, shu and re differ in subtle but important ways. Generally speaking, re is a broader concept referring to any state of high temperature, whereas shu specifically denotes the peculiar damp, stifling heat of summer. The ancients long recognized this distinction. Later scholars distinguished between shu and yu (燠) and between shu and re, arguing that "shu approximates the humid, steaming kind of heat, while re approximates the dry, baking kind." This distinction is critically important, for it directly relates to the Great Heat phenological phrase "the earth is moist and the heat sultry" (tu run ru shu) — the heat of Great Heat is precisely that damp, steaming, clammy swelter of shu, not the dry, scorching heat of re.
Why does shu take "sun" as its radical$9 Because the root of summer heat lies in the sun. The sun's light and warmth are the source of all shu-heat. Through the radical "sun," the ancients firmly tethered this climate condition to the sun itself — this is not an abstract concept of temperature but a phenomenon with a definite astronomical origin. When the sun's accumulated radiance reaches a certain threshold, the ground, the air, and all things are baked through; combined with the abundant moisture that evaporates in summer, the distinctive quality of shu takes form.
Here is a question worth pondering: why did the ancients bother to coin a separate character for summer's humid heat$10 Would "summer's heat" not have sufficed$11
The answer is that the ancients' naming of natural phenomena was never arbitrary labeling but a precise grasp of essential characteristics. What shu captures is the quality of summer heat, not merely its quantity. Summer heat differs from the heat of a brazier or the heat of sunburn; it possesses a pervasive, steaming, all-penetrating quality. To create the character shu was to fix this distinctive "quality of heat" so that it became a concept that could be spoken of, recorded, and incorporated into the cosmic order.
II. Why "Great" Heat$12 The Gradation of Summer Swelter
Shu alone is not enough. What makes Great Heat "great" is precisely that word da (大, "great"). Why should summer heat be divided into greater and lesser$13 What exactly distinguishes Lesser Heat (Xiaoshu) from Great Heat$14
Master Wu Cheng in the Collected Explanations of the Seventy-Two Pentads of the Monthly Ordinances offers an admirably precise explanation. Regarding Lesser Heat he writes: "The sixth-month node. The Shuowen says: shu means heat. Within heat one may further distinguish great and small: at the beginning of the month it is small, at the middle of the month it is great; at present the hot energy is still small." As for Great Heat: "The weather at this time is far fiercer than at Lesser Heat, hence the name Great Heat" — the summer swelter is now far more intense than at Lesser Heat, and so it is called Great Heat.
Reading these two passages together, we see the ancients' exquisite precision. A single character, shu, could broadly cover the whole of midsummer's heat. But the ancients felt this was not precise enough, and so they "further distinguished great and small within heat" — subdividing degrees of intensity within the scorching season. At the beginning of the month (Lesser Heat) the hot energy is still small; at the middle of the month (Great Heat) it has reached "the utmost of hot energy."
This practice of "dividing into great and small" reflects the extraordinary refinement of the ancients' observation of celestial timing! They were not content with the rough judgment "summer is very hot," but pressed further: How hot exactly$15 Is the heat still gathering or has it peaked$16 Is its trend rising or falling$17 Precisely through this subdivision into Lesser Heat and Great Heat, the ancients traced the midsummer temperature curve with clarity — from the "approaching but not yet extreme heat" of Lesser Heat to the "heat extreme and exuberant" of Great Heat.
At a still deeper level, da ("great") here is not merely an intensifier; it carries profound philosophical weight. In pre-Qin thought, da was never simply equivalent to "very." Laozi (the Most High) wrote: "There was something formless yet complete, born before heaven and earth. … I do not know its name; I style it 'the Way'; forced to give it a name, I call it 'the Great'" (Daodejing, Chapter 25). "Great" is one of the aliases of the Way. "Great" signifies having reached a certain extreme, a certain fullness, a state beyond which nothing further can be added.
The "great" in Great Heat carries exactly this sense — it is the state in which summer heat has reached its extreme, its absolute apex. And in pre-Qin dialectical thinking, the moment anything reaches "greatness," reaches its extreme, it is on the verge of turning into its opposite. The Most High wrote: "The Great means passing away; passing away means going far; going far means returning" (Daodejing, Chapter 25). Greatness leads to passage, passage leads to distance, distance leads to return. The "great" in Great Heat is precisely the critical turning point on this chain of "great — passing — far — returning": when the heat reaches "great," it means it is about to "pass away," about to move toward autumn's coolness and winter's cold. This is the deepest philosophical cipher embedded in the name "Great Heat": the very name of supreme flourishing already conceals the seeds of decline.
III. "Great Heat" and "Great Cold": The Symmetry of the Year's Two Poles
Among the twenty-four solar terms, "Great Heat" has a distant counterpart — "Great Cold" (Dahan). One marks the hottest time of the year, the other the coldest; one falls in the sixth month, the other in the twelfth; one represents the extreme of Fire virtue, the other the extreme of Water virtue. This symmetry of naming is no accident.
Why did the ancients give the year's two extremes the same "Great" structure$18 Embedded here is a fundamental recognition of the way the cosmos operates: the Way of Heaven is cyclical, bipolar, and oscillates between its two poles. Within the year there is a pole where yang energy reaches its maximum (Great Heat) and a pole where yin energy reaches its maximum (Great Cold). These two poles are like two points on opposite sides of an immense ring, marking the two endpoints of heaven's circuit.
The Xici Zhuan (Appended Statements) of the Book of Changes declares: "One yin and one yang — this is called the Way." The Way is the alternating movement of yin and yang. Great Heat is the extreme of "yang," Great Cold the extreme of "yin." But the point of extremity is precisely the point of reversal. After Great Heat, yang energy — though still strong — wanes daily, while yin energy — though still faint — waxes daily; after Great Cold, yin energy — though still strong — wanes daily, while yang energy — though still faint — waxes daily. The two poles echo each other, composing a complete, ceaselessly generative cycle.
This symmetry also reminds us of a profound truth: extreme heat and extreme cold are structurally isomorphic. Both are "extremes," both are tipping points where reversal into the opposite becomes inevitable, both conceal the opportunity for transformation. To understand that within the depths of Great Cold yang energy is being born is to understand that within Great Heat yin energy is already latent; to understand "at the Winter Solstice, a single yang is born" is to understand "at the Summer Solstice, a single yin is born" — and Great Heat is precisely the moment after the Summer Solstice when that single yin has been gradually growing and is about to become unmistakable. Through the symmetric naming of Great Heat and Great Cold, the ancients embedded the wisdom of this cycle deep within the system of solar terms.
